Magazine - Old World Charm 12"

This years Record Store Day Farce sees yet another limited edition Magazine 12" issued.Record Store Day - April 2017.

Titled "Old World Charm" Wire Sound 12" Limited to 1000 / Download card 

‘Welcome, ladies & gentlemen, to the genuine old world charm of
Magazine’…Following on from last year’s ‘Once @ The Academy’ RSD 12" vinyl release, Magazine issue a sister release for RSD 2017. The 6-track EP, ‘Old World Charm’, is limited to 1000 pressings and this time contains live recordings from the 2009 BBC Electric Proms performance @ the Camden Roundhouse, London. 

Magazine played a 45-minute set featuring selected A & B sides of their previous single releases. Half of the set is captured here.

Track listing: Shot By Both Sides; Rhythm Of Cruelty; A Song
From Under The Floorboards; Side B: Feed The Enemy;
Sweetheart Contract; I Love You, You Big Dummy

Buzzcocks - 40 Year Anniversary Box Set Arrives.










So, I'm down in London and I get the text from the courier your Buzzcocks box sets are due to be delivered today - Arghhh.

Fortunately I got back in time to take delivery and boy where these bad boys worth waiting for.  As collectors items go these are ace. 


Limited to just 1000 I got Boxes 233 and 235 One remains sealed and the other I have opened so you can see what's in it.

There's not many left though now so if you want one get online and order it from Domino records.

So here goes:


Times Up Vinyl LP.




7" Spiral Scratch E.P.
 






Downloads Postcard this allows you to get the MP3 and WAV files plus Breakdown Video from The Free Trade Hall gig 1976.




Booklet that has a great run down of the band at this time.









Shy Talk - Manchester Fanzine 


Various Postcards based upon Tickets and Flyers from Buzzcocks gigs.








Series of Photographs.






Repro Posters.



Repro of Spiral Scratch Master Tape Box Lid.



Badges.


Times Up CD.



Spiral Scratch E.P. CD.
